Norther generates first power from its 370 MW offshore wind project in Zeebrugge

Norther has begun supplying power to the Belgian through its under-construction 370 MW offshore wind project off the coast of Zeebrugge. The first power is provided by the already finished four wind turbines. 

The installation of Norther's 44 turbines began in January. It is the final and most crucial stage in the construction of Belgium's largest offshore wind farm. Twelve turbines have already been installed and the initial power generates by the first turbines are being connected to Stevin, the new high-voltage station of Elia in Zeebrugge. That way, the wind energy generated will flow into the power grid and will be sold to Engie (50%) and Eneco (50%). On final delivery, Norther’s electricity supply will cover 400,000 families' energy usage.

The Norther wind farm is located 23 kilometers off the haven of Ostend and has a total capacity of 370 megawatts, the largest capacity of all Belgian wind farms. This way, Norther is actively contributing towards Belgium's 2020 climate targets.

Norther—a project led by shareholders Elicio, Eneco, and DGE (wholly owned subsidiary of Mitsubishi Corporation)—will be fully operational this summer.
